Key Takeaways

  • The podcast “Summer S’mores with Conan and his Chill Chums” is returning for its fifth installment, with the decision made to host it in Conan’s backyard at Larchmont Studios.
  • The decision to use the backyard was influenced by factors like convenience, potential tax write-offs, and a desire for a more intimate setting, despite initial considerations for exotic locations like St. Barts.
  • The conversation touches on the history of the “Summer S’mores” gatherings, the impact of recent events (like house fires) on locations, and the humorous discussion about the backyard’s size and its current use by the hosts’ dogs.
